Глюк в Browse

Clarion, Clarion 7

Модератор: Дед Пахом

Правила форума
При написании вопроса или обсуждении проблемы, не забывайте указывать версию Clarion который Вы используете.
А так же пользуйтесь спец. тегами при вставке исходников!!!
Ответить
dik1970
Посетитель
Сообщения: 43
Зарегистрирован: 06 Август 2009, 23:39

Глюк в Browse

Сообщение dik1970 »

Добрый день. Кто-нить сталкивался с такой бедой: В окне Browse при построчном перемещении вверх списка с помощью стрелки вверх на клаве либо с помощью скролбара как только достигается конец страницы вместо дальнейшего списка выдаются чередующиеся две строки - последняя с текущей страницы и первая со следующей. При постраничном перемещении или при движении вниз - все в порядке. Clarion 6.3 -9058, шаблоны Legasy.
lsgsoftware
Ветеран
Сообщения: 311
Зарегистрирован: 08 Июль 2005, 22:04

Re: Глюк в Browse

Сообщение lsgsoftware »

Ну начну с того,что ты не написал,с какой моделью данных Ты работаешь.
Это может быть DAT,TPS, какая-нибудь приличная СУБД.А вообще для меня
эта проблема знакома.Причины для файловых моделей-это проблемы с ключами.
Выход-пересортировка файлов с данными и обязательно добавить в структуру
данных-таблиц PRIMARY-ключ.Тогда жить можно.
dik1970
Посетитель
Сообщения: 43
Зарегистрирован: 06 Август 2009, 23:39

Re: Глюк в Browse

Сообщение dik1970 »

Да, конечно , стоило упомянуть что формат TPS. Принудительная переиндексация не помогает, первичный ключ задан, правда, в указанном Browse сортировка не по нему.
dik1970
Посетитель
Сообщения: 43
Зарегистрирован: 06 Август 2009, 23:39

Re: Глюк в Browse

Сообщение dik1970 »

Удалось устранить путем построчной перезаписи файла.
Тема закрыта
Ответить